网络监控告警如何实现故障预测?
在信息化时代,网络作为企业运营的基石,其稳定性和安全性至关重要。然而,网络故障时有发生,如何实现故障预测,提高网络监控告警的准确性,成为企业关注的焦点。本文将深入探讨网络监控告警如何实现故障预测,以期为相关企业提供有益的参考。
一、网络监控告警的意义
网络监控告警是指在网络运行过程中,通过监控设备对网络流量、设备状态、性能指标等进行实时监测,当发现异常情况时,及时发出警报,提醒管理员采取相应措施。网络监控告警具有以下意义:
及时发现故障:通过实时监控,及时发现网络故障,避免故障扩大,减少对企业运营的影响。
提高网络安全性:及时发现并处理网络攻击、病毒入侵等安全问题,保障企业信息安全。
优化网络性能:通过监控网络性能指标,分析网络瓶颈,优化网络架构,提高网络运行效率。
二、网络监控告警实现故障预测的关键技术
历史数据挖掘:通过对历史网络数据进行分析,挖掘故障发生的规律和趋势,为故障预测提供依据。
机器学习算法:利用机器学习算法,对网络数据进行建模,预测故障发生的可能性。
深度学习技术:通过深度学习技术,对网络数据进行特征提取,提高故障预测的准确性。
异常检测算法:利用异常检测算法,实时监测网络数据,发现异常情况,提前预警。
三、网络监控告警实现故障预测的步骤
数据采集:收集网络流量、设备状态、性能指标等数据,为故障预测提供基础。
数据预处理:对采集到的数据进行清洗、转换等处理,提高数据质量。
特征提取:从预处理后的数据中提取关键特征,为后续分析提供支持。
模型训练:利用机器学习算法,对提取的特征进行建模,训练故障预测模型。
模型评估:对训练好的模型进行评估,确保模型的准确性和可靠性。
故障预测:利用训练好的模型,对实时数据进行预测,提前预警故障发生。
四、案例分析
某企业采用网络监控告警系统,通过历史数据挖掘和机器学习算法,实现了故障预测。以下为该案例的具体情况:
数据采集:该企业收集了过去一年的网络流量、设备状态、性能指标等数据。
数据预处理:对采集到的数据进行清洗、转换等处理,确保数据质量。
特征提取:从预处理后的数据中提取了网络带宽、设备温度、CPU利用率等关键特征。
模型训练:利用机器学习算法,对提取的特征进行建模,训练故障预测模型。
模型评估:对训练好的模型进行评估,准确率达到90%。
故障预测:在预测期间,系统成功预测了5次故障,提前预警,避免了故障扩大。
五、总结
网络监控告警在故障预测中发挥着重要作用。通过历史数据挖掘、机器学习算法、深度学习技术和异常检测算法等关键技术,实现故障预测,提高网络监控告警的准确性。企业应重视网络监控告警系统建设,充分利用故障预测技术,保障网络稳定运行。
猜你喜欢:全栈链路追踪